Early Years Foundation Stage

Our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) provides a warm, nurturing, and inclusive environment where every child is valued as a unique individual. As a small rural primary school, we make the most of our close community and beautiful natural surroundings to create a rich and engaging curriculum that builds strong foundations for lifelong learning. Our EYFS are a part of Maple Class (EYFS, Year 1 and Year 2), benefitting from the expertise of our committed team: Mrs Trinder, Mrs Wenban, Mrs Sneddon-Wilkins, Mrs Reed and Miss Scrivens. Our new starters also benefit from buddies from Elder Class, who help them settle quickly into life at Sapperton, share the love of reading in Reading Buddy Time and make them feel special and valued from the moment they start their school journey.

All of our children develop a love of learning through play, exploration, and meaningful experiences. We aim to foster children’s curiosity, independence, and resilience, while promoting kindness, respect, and a sense of belonging within our school and wider community. The children have timetabled Forest School weekly, PE taught through trained specific sports coaches and access to the woods that surround the school.

Through carefully planned provision and a balance of adult-led and child-initiated learning, we strive to develop children’s communication, language, physical, and social skills. We prioritise strong early literacy and numeracy foundations, alongside opportunities to explore nature, creativity, and problem-solving in real-life, hands-on contexts.
